recycle.html 9.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188
  1. <!DOCTYPE html>
  2. <html>
  3. <head>
  4. <meta charset="utf-8">
  5. <title>回收站</title>
  6. </head>
  7. <body class="laytp-container-recycle">
  8. <div class="layui-card" id="recycle-search-form" style="display:none;">
  9. <div class="layui-card-body">
  10. <form class="layui-form" style="margin-bottom:0px;">
  11. <div class="layui-form-item layui-inline">
  12. <label class="layui-form-label" title="ID">ID</label>
  13. <div class="layui-input-inline">
  14. <input type="text" name="search_param[id][value]" id="id" placeholder="请输入ID"
  15. class="layui-input" autocomplete="off">
  16. <input type="hidden" name="search_param[id][condition]" value="=">
  17. </div>
  18. </div>
  19. <div class="layui-form-item layui-inline">
  20. <label class="layui-form-label" title="所属分类">所属分类</label>
  21. <div class="layui-input-inline">
  22. <div class="xmSelect"
  23. data-name="search_param[category_id][value]"
  24. data-sourceType="route"
  25. data-source="/admin.files.category/index"
  26. data-sourceTree="true"
  27. data-paging="false"
  28. data-valueField="id"
  29. data-textField="name"
  30. data-placeholder="请选择所属分类"
  31. ></div>
  32. <input type="hidden" name="search_param[category_id][condition]" value="FIND_IN_SET">
  33. </div>
  34. </div>
  35. <div class="layui-form-item layui-inline">
  36. <label class="layui-form-label" title="文件名称">文件名称</label>
  37. <div class="layui-input-inline">
  38. <input autocomplete="off" type="text" id="name" name="search_param[name][value]" placeholder="请输入文件名称" class="layui-input">
  39. <input type="hidden" name="search_param[name][condition]" value="LIKE">
  40. </div>
  41. </div>
  42. <div class="layui-form-item layui-inline">
  43. <label class="layui-form-label" title="文件类型">文件类型</label>
  44. <div class="layui-input-inline">
  45. <select id="file_type" name="search_param[file_type][value]">
  46. <option value="">请选择文件类型</option>
  47. <option value=""></option>
  48. <option value="image">图片</option>
  49. <option value="video">视频</option>
  50. <option value="music">音频</option>
  51. <option value="file">文件</option>
  52. </select>
  53. <input type="hidden" name="search_param[file_type][condition]" value="=">
  54. </div>
  55. </div>
  56. <div class="layui-form-item layui-inline">
  57. <label class="layui-form-label" title="上传方式">上传方式</label>
  58. <div class="layui-input-inline">
  59. <select id="upload_type" name="search_param[upload_type][value]">
  60. <option value="">请选择上传方式</option>
  61. <option value=""></option>
  62. <option value="local">本地上传</option>
  63. <option value="ali-oss">阿里云OSS</option>
  64. <option value="qiniu-kodo">七牛云KODO</option>
  65. </select>
  66. <input type="hidden" name="search_param[upload_type][condition]" value="=">
  67. </div>
  68. </div>
  69. <div class="layui-form-item layui-inline">
  70. <label class="layui-form-label" title="创建者">创建者</label>
  71. <div class="layui-input-inline">
  72. <div class="xmSelect"
  73. data-name="search_param[create_admin_user_id][value]"
  74. data-sourceType="route"
  75. data-source="/admin.user/index"
  76. data-sourceTree="false"
  77. data-paging="true"
  78. data-valueField="id"
  79. data-textField="nickname"
  80. data-placeholder="请选择创建者"
  81. ></div>
  82. <input type="hidden" name="search_param[create_admin_user_id][condition]" value="FIND_IN_SET">
  83. </div>
  84. </div>
  85. <div class="layui-form-item layui-inline">
  86. <label class="layui-form-label" title="最后更新者">最后更新者</label>
  87. <div class="layui-input-inline">
  88. <div class="xmSelect"
  89. data-name="search_param[update_admin_user_id][value]"
  90. data-sourceType="route"
  91. data-source="/admin.user/index"
  92. data-sourceTree="false"
  93. data-paging="true"
  94. data-valueField="id"
  95. data-textField="nickname"
  96. data-placeholder="请选择最后更新者"
  97. ></div>
  98. <input type="hidden" name="search_param[update_admin_user_id][condition]" value="FIND_IN_SET">
  99. </div>
  100. </div>
  101. <div class="layui-form-item layui-inline">
  102. <label class="layui-form-label" title="创建时间">创建时间</label>
  103. <div class="layui-input-inline">
  104. <input type="text" class="layui-input laydate"
  105. id="create_time" name="search_param[create_time][value]"
  106. data-type="datetime" data-isRange="true" placeholder="请选择创建时间">
  107. <input type="hidden" name="search_param[create_time][condition]" value="BETWEEN">
  108. </div>
  109. </div>
  110. <div class="layui-form-item layui-inline">
  111. <label class="layui-form-label" title="更新时间">更新时间</label>
  112. <div class="layui-input-inline">
  113. <input type="text" class="layui-input laydate"
  114. id="update_time" name="search_param[update_time][value]"
  115. data-type="datetime" data-isRange="true" placeholder="请选择更新时间">
  116. <input type="hidden" name="search_param[update_time][condition]" value="BETWEEN">
  117. </div>
  118. </div>
  119. <div class="layui-form-item layui-inline">
  120. <label class="layui-form-label" title="删除时间">删除时间</label>
  121. <div class="layui-input-inline">
  122. <input type="text" class="layui-input laydate"
  123. id="delete_time" name="search_param[delete_time][value]"
  124. data-type="datetime" data-isRange="true" placeholder="请选择删除时间">
  125. <input type="hidden" name="search_param[delete_time][condition]" value="BETWEEN">
  126. </div>
  127. </div>
  128. <div class="layui-form-item layui-inline">
  129. <button class="laytp-btn laytp-btn-md laytp-btn-primary" lay-submit lay-filter="laytp-recycle-search-form">
  130. <i class="layui-icon layui-icon-search"></i>
  131. 查询
  132. </button>
  133. <button type="reset" class="laytp-btn laytp-btn-md laytp-recycle-search-form-reset">
  134. <i class="layui-icon layui-icon-refresh"></i>
  135. 重置
  136. </button>
  137. </div>
  138. </form>
  139. </div>
  140. </div>
  141. <table id="laytp-recycle-table" lay-filter="laytp-recycle-table"></table>
  142. <script type="text/html" id="recycle-default-toolbar">
  143. <button class="laytp-btn laytp-btn-primary laytp-btn-md" lay-event="restore">
  144. <i class="laytp-icon laytp-icon-back"></i>
  145. 还原
  146. </button>
  147. <button class="laytp-btn laytp-btn-danger laytp-btn-md" lay-event="true-del">
  148. <i class="layui-icon layui-icon-delete"></i>
  149. 删除
  150. </button>
  151. <button class="laytp-btn laytp-btn-warming laytp-btn-md" lay-event="recycle-search">
  152. <i class="layui-icon layui-icon-search"></i>
  153. 搜索
  154. </button>
  155. </script>
  156. <script type="text/html" id="recycle-default-bar">
  157. <button class="laytp-btn laytp-btn-primary laytp-btn-xs" lay-event="restore"><i class="laytp-icon laytp-icon-back"></i>还原</button>
  158. <button class="laytp-btn laytp-btn-danger laytp-btn-xs" lay-event="true-del"><i class="layui-icon layui-icon-delete"></i>删除</button>
  159. </script>
  160. <script>
  161. if(localStorage.getItem("staticDomain")){
  162. document.write("<link rel='stylesheet' href='" + localStorage.getItem("staticDomain") + "/component/layui/css/layui.css?v=" + localStorage.getItem("version") + "'>");
  163. document.write("<script src='" + localStorage.getItem("staticDomain") + "/component/layui/layui.js?v="+localStorage.getItem("version")+"'><\/script>");
  164. document.write("<script src='" + localStorage.getItem("staticDomain") + "/component/laytp/layuiConfig.js?v="+localStorage.getItem("version")+"'><\/script>");
  165. document.write("<script src='" + localStorage.getItem("staticDomain") + "/admin/js/filesRecycle.js?v="+localStorage.getItem("version")+"'><\/script>");
  166. }else{
  167. document.write("<link rel='stylesheet' href='/static/component/layui/css/layui.css?v=" + localStorage.getItem("version") + "'>");
  168. document.write("<script src='/static/component/layui/layui.js?v="+localStorage.getItem("version")+"'><\/script>");
  169. document.write("<script src='/static/component/laytp/layuiConfig.js?v="+localStorage.getItem("version")+"'><\/script>");
  170. document.write("<script src='/static/admin/js/filesRecycle.js?v="+localStorage.getItem("version")+"'><\/script>");
  171. }
  172. </script>
  173. </body>
  174. </html>